On July 23, 2020, the California Transportation Foundation convened a panel of transportation professionals for the webinar “Transportation Outlook: Moving Beyond COVID-19.” The panelists discussed the impacts of the coronavirus and what the future holds for California’s transportation sector in the wake of the pandemic. An end to the coronavirus pandemic is far from certain, but these difficult times have underscored the transportation sector’s resilience. By the panel’s conclusion, it was clear that the collaborative spirit and problem-solving mindset of those working in the transportation industry have been essential to weathering a global crisis over the last several months, and that such qualities will continue to shape California’s transportation future.
